Fog and Condensation

If there is a spotting of moisture between the window panes, it's a sign that your glass is not insulated properly. This means your windows aren't as effective as they should be in keeping heat in during the winter months and cool air out in summer. The good part is that it's typically possible to fix the issue without replacing the entire window.

Insulated glass units (IGUs) are used in most modern triple-pane and double glazed glass replacement-pane windows. They are made up of two or more panes of glass that are held together by a rubber gasket and inert gases such as argon or Krypton. As time passes these gases may be deficient, which allows moisture to get inside the glass and result in condensation.

Foggy windows are a typical problem, especially in humid locations where temperature fluctuations can cause the gasket to break down and allow moisture to enter. If this is not taken care of, it could lead to a major loss in energy efficiency, and eventually cause damage to the wooden frames and glass of your windows.

There are a myriad of ways to fix the problem fogging of double-paned windows. One method is to drill a hole between the two panes of glass and spray them with a defogging solution. The solution will remove any mildew that has built up and suck away any excess moisture. This method is typically only suitable for glass that has been softened however, because it will damage toughened and safety glass when used on them.

Poor Insulation

Double-pane windows of today are typically coated with argon gas to prevent heat loss. This non-toxic and inert gas helps keep your home cooler during summer and warmer in the winter. It's also one of the most advanced features of modern windows, and can increase the efficiency of your home by lowering your energy costs. If you've noticed that your window has lost a substantial amount of gas argon an expert in window repair will use a specific tool to replace it.

When a double-pane window seal fails it allows cold or hot air to flow between the two glass panes. This can decrease the insulating properties of your window, and put unnecessary stress on your home’s heating or cooling systems. This problem should be addressed as soon as possible, as it can lead greater energy costs and require more repairs.
